How Digital Game Discovery Is Changing
The traditional approach to finding a new game often depended on recommendations from friends, magazines, advertisements, physical stores, or word of mouth. Digital platforms have transformed this process by putting thousands of titles within reach almost instantly. Players can now encounter games through categories, personalized suggestions, community activity, search functions, developer showcases, seasonal events, and platform-based promotions.
However, having more information does not automatically create a better discovery experience. When hundreds or thousands of games are presented at once, users can experience decision fatigue. A player looking for a relaxing strategy game may have to move through numerous unrelated results before finding something suitable. Someone interested in a new multiplayer experience may encounter games that do not match their preferred style or level of complexity.
This is where structured discovery becomes valuable. Modern gaming ecosystems increasingly need to understand that players do not simply want access to large catalogs. They want useful pathways through those catalogs. Search tools, categories, filters, recommendations, recently played sections, and curated collections can all reduce unnecessary browsing. The goal is to transform a large digital library into an environment where useful choices become easier to identify.

Search and Filtering Reduce Discovery Friction
Search is another fundamental part of a modern gaming ecosystem. A good search experience should help users move from a broad intention to a manageable selection. Someone searching for an action game, for example, may want additional ways to narrow results according to gameplay style, release period, multiplayer support, or other relevant characteristics.
Filtering can be particularly useful when a platform contains a large number of games. Rather than presenting every possible option, filters allow users to remove irrelevant results. This can make discovery faster without reducing the overall size of the available catalog.
The key is balance. Too few filters can leave users with overwhelming results, while too many complicated settings can make the process frustrating. Effective digital discovery should therefore keep the most useful controls accessible while allowing users to explore deeper options when necessary.
Personalization Can Improve Game Discovery
Personalization has become an important part of many digital experiences, and gaming is no exception. Players have different preferences, play styles, schedules, and levels of experience. A recommendation system that recognizes those differences can potentially make discovery more relevant than a generic list of popular titles.
For example, a player who regularly explores cooperative games may find greater value in recommendations related to multiplayer experiences than in a general list of trending releases. Similarly, someone who frequently plays shorter games may prefer recommendations that fit limited gaming sessions. Personalization can therefore help connect player behavior with more appropriate discovery opportunities.

Why Faster Discovery Matters for Modern Gamers
Faster discovery is valuable because gaming time is not unlimited. Many players balance gaming with work, education, family responsibilities, and other activities. When a significant portion of a limited gaming session is spent deciding what to play, the actual experience becomes shorter.
Efficient discovery can reduce that unnecessary decision-making. A player who can quickly identify several relevant options has more time to evaluate the games themselves. This is especially useful for digital platforms where new titles and updates can appear frequently.
There is also an exploratory benefit. When discovery is simple, players may become more willing to try unfamiliar genres or independent titles. A complicated browsing experience can encourage users to return repeatedly to the same familiar games, while a more accessible environment can make experimentation feel easier.

The Future of Digital Game Discovery
The future of game discovery is likely to become increasingly contextual. Instead of simply asking users to search for a title, digital ecosystems can increasingly help them discover experiences based on what they are doing, what they have played previously, and what type of session they want to have.
For example, a player starting a short gaming session may benefit from different suggestions than someone preparing for a long weekend of gaming. Likewise, someone playing alone may have different discovery requirements from a group looking for a cooperative experience. Context-aware discovery can make digital libraries feel more responsive without necessarily limiting user choice.
Artificial intelligence and improved recommendation technologies may further influence this direction. However, useful discovery should remain transparent and user-controlled. Recommendations work best when they assist exploration rather than replacing the player’s ability to browse independently.
